David Fetter <david@fetter.org> writes:
> On Sat, Apr 11, 2009 at 08:52:31AM -0400, Robert Haas wrote:
>> We're up to at least four different categories of functions that
>> people think might require special treatment: window, trigger, I/O,
>> everything else.

> The current psql has \da and \df, the latter of which now includes I/O
> functions.  I contend that windowing functions are different enough
> that they require a separate category.

I think the fact that aggregates have a separate command is somewhat
historical.  However, the fact remains that at the SQL level there is
CREATE/DROP/etc AGGREGATE and CREATE/DROP/etc FUNCTION, and nothing
else.  If we don't hang psql's hat on that same hook then we are going
to confuse users --- not to mention that this thread will never reach a
resolution because there will be too many alternatives.
